About

Dryft is an agentic AI operating system for manufacturing that combines context-aware AI agents with mathematical optimization to automate complex operational decisions — from order quantities and safety stock adjustments to supplier coordination. Founded in 2024 by Anna-Julia Storch and Leonie Freisinger (Stanford alums with backgrounds in professional athletics and Porsche drivetrain software), Dryft builds a contextual representation of industrial knowledge for each factory's unique parts, materials, and suppliers, replacing static rules-based systems with adaptive, self-correcting workflows. The company has delivered seven-figure annual savings for European and U.S. industrial manufacturers and is backed by General Catalyst.

Summary

Dryft is an Artificial Intelligence company based in Palo Alto, United States, founded in 2024. It has raised $5.0M in total across 1 round, most recently a $5.0M Seed round in Nov 2025. Investors include General Catalyst, Neo Ventures and Sandberg Bernthal Venture Partners.
